How Our Residential Water Removal Process Works

At our company, we believe that a proper process is key to successful Residential Water Removal. That’s why we’ve developed a step-by-step approach that ensures every job is done right the first time.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an that meets your unique needs and budget.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ll send a trained technician to your property to assess the damage and develop a plan for the restoration process. This includes identifying the source of the water, evaluating the extent of the damage, and determining the best course of action.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our technicians will use advanced equipment to extract as much water as possible from your property. This includes powerful pumps, wet/dry vacuums, and other specialized tools designed to reduce damage and prevent further water intrusion.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

After the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your property and prevent further moisture buildup. This includes industrial-strength dehumidifiers, air movers, and other tools designed to speed up the drying process.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ting

Once your property is dry, our technicians will clean and disinfect all surfaces to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This includes scrubbing floors, walls, and ceilings, as well as disinfecting any affected areas.

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ction

Finally, our team will work with you to repair and reconstruct any damaged areas of your property. This includes installing new drywall, flooring, and other materials as needed.

Warning Signs You Need Residential Water Removal

Water damage can be sneaky, but there are often warning signs that show a problem.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are a few common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it may be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by mold and mildew growing in the affected area, and it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, particularly if it’s accompanied by other warning signs like musty odors or water stains.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ains on wal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age, and it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Visible Water Damage or Leaks

If you notice visible water damage or leaks in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Increased Humidity or Moisture

Increased humidity or moisture in your home can be a sign of water damage, particularly if it’s accompanied by other warning signs like musty odors or water stains.

Discoloration or Fading of Paint or Wallpaper

Discoloration or fading of pa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age, particularly if it’s accompanied by other warning signs like musty odors or water stains.

Residential Water Removal Cost in East Lake, FL

The cost of Residential Water Removal in East Lake,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the drying process.
Cleaning and disinfecting $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the level of cleaning required.
Repair and re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the materials required for repair.
